Output e9ecd3fc0884fdde06a7f961a71a3022f3d23bee187be7fe43301deb9c6f99a1:1

value
2389440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70bf1577ceddde527a46a80dbe130d632e8a0231 OP_EQUAL
address
DFRF8UxEXH4oPvjBzA4kXzRjjmLayBTgL8
transaction
e9ecd3fc0884fdde06a7f961a71a3022f3d23bee187be7fe43301deb9c6f99a1
spent
true